Background:
We aim to comprehensively assess the prognostic performance of AFR and FA scores in patients with lung cancer (LC).
Methods:
We conducted a comprehensive search of PubMed, Web of Science, and CNKI databases to identify relevant studies. The primary endpoints assessed were overall survival (OS) and progression-free survival (PFS). Integrated hazard ratios (HRs) with 95% confidence intervals (CIs) were calculated through pooling analysis.
Results:
A total of 3145 participants from 10 studies were included in the analysis. In LC patients, the pooled results showed that low AFR predicted a worse outcome for OS (HR 1.76, 95% CI 1.51-2.06, p < 0.001) and PFS (HR 1.50, 95% CI 1.29-1.74, p < 0.001), and high FA score was associated with worse OS (HR 2.61, 95% CI 1.75-3.90, p < 0.001) and PFS (HR 2.38, 95% CI 1.60-3.55, p < 0.001).
Conclusion:
This meta-analysis demonstrated that a low AFR and a high FA score were associated with an increased risk of mortality and disease progression in LC, suggesting their potential as prognostic biomarkers.
